SUMMARY

The principal product owner will be responsible for overseeing the successful delivery of our manufacturing & supply chain technology product team at Renewal by Andersen in Locust Grove, GA. The ideal candidate will have a strong understanding of project & agile management principles.

QUALIFICATIONS AND SKILLS

  • Bachelor’s or master’s degree in a field such as computer science, engineering, business, or a related discipline.
  • 3+ years of professional experience in a delivery management or project management role.
  • Strong leadership and communication skills, enjoy problem-solving, and can manage multiple tasks simultaneously.
  • Track record of successfully leading cross-functional teams and working with clients to deliver high-quality projects on time and within budget.
  • Ability to adapt to new technologies and environments and their problem-solving and communication skills.
Responsibilities
  • Partner with business and IT (Information Technology) stakeholders to ensure project deliverables align with customer requirements.
  • Lead cross-functional planning and prioritization meetings to drive alignment on the latest adjustments to the market and homeowner expectations.
  • Communicate with stakeholders, team members and clients to ensure that everyone is informed about the progress of the delivery.
  • Develop and implement delivery plans, which include defining project scope, milestones, and timelines.
  • Manage the budget and resources to ensure the project stays on track and budget.
  • Identify and manage risks to the delivery, which includes developing contingency plans to mitigate potential issues.
  • Track progress and adjust as needed to keep the delivery on track.
  • Prioritize quality assurance throughout the project lifecycle by defining and monitoring quality standards, conducting regular quality reviews, and implementing quality control measures.
  • Provide guidance and mentorship to team members to ensure that they have the skills and support they need to complete their tasks.
  • Lead and manage a team of 10-12 business analysts, developers, QA, project managers, product owners, and scrum masters.
